
316H Stainless Steel
316H is a high-carbon austenitic stainless steel grade, a modified version of UNS S31600. Its chemical composition specifies 16.0-18.0% Cr, 10.0-14.0% Ni, 2.0-3.0% Mo, with carbon controlled between 0.04-0.10%—exceeding standard 316’s 0.08% maximum.
This intentional carbon elevation enhances high-temperature creep resistance and rupture strength, critical for sustained service at 650-870°C. It maintains excellent pitting and crevice corrosion resistance in chloride environments, inherited from 316’s molybdenum addition.

Feature
Specially optimized for high-temperature service conditions, this material significantly enhances elevated-temperature strength and creep resistance through controlled carbon content, while maintaining the fundamental corrosion resistance of the 316 series.
Applications
Energy & Thermal Systems: Supercritical boiler tubes, cracking furnace tubes (long-term service below 800°C).
Petrochemical Equipment: High-temperature/pressure reactors, hydrogenation unit components.
Special Load-Bearing Parts: Aircraft engine fasteners, hot-working molds.
